You will be involved in multiple delivery workstreams that integrate Credit Risk decisioning into the Banks sales channels and processes. You will also be supporting our customers in receiving the best possible end to end experience.

The way that we deliver change is progressive and we expect you to bring pragmatic ideas to the team and have an opportunity to implement them within our Change Management framework.

The difference you'll make:

  • Supporting the execution of initiatives/projects within a Risk Transformation plan
  • Working closely with other stakeholders from Retail Risk and/or from other areas of the Bank, including Retail Business, Technology and Operations
  • Supporting initiatives to deliver the most appropriate / best outcome for the customers (internal and/or external)
  • Acting as a representative from Risk
  • Facilitating the challenge of current processes and support initiatives to develop and implement a best-in-class operating model for Risk
  • Embedding change management standards and tools in all change projects in the Risk division

What you'll bring:

  • Risk experience in any risk class at analyst level (Market, Credit, Operational, Enterprise)
  • Projects and Change experience

It would also be nice for you to have:

  • Logical thinking and good data analysis skills with the ability to manipulate large data sets
  • Stakeholder management experience, and the ability to work independent and prioritise work loads
  • Knowledge or experience in JIRA, Confluence
  • Experience in banking/financial services industry

How we'll reward you:

As well as a salary, we offer a wide range of benefits that you can choose from and tailor to your needs.

  • £500 annual cash allowance to spend on our great range of benefits
  • Eligible for a discretionary performance-related annual bonus
  • We put 8% of salary into your pension, even if you don't contribute yourself. We'll pay in up to 12.5% of salary, if you contribute as well, and you can take some of our contribution in cash if you prefer
  • 27 days' holiday plus bank holidays, which increases to 28 days after 5yrs service, with the option to purchase up to 5 contractual days per year
  • Voluntary healthcare benefits at discounted rates. Including: Bupa medical insurance, dental insurance, healthcare cash plan and health assessments
  • Benefits supporting you and your family, such as death-in-service benefit, income protection, and voluntary life assurance and critical illness cover
  • 24/7 access to an online employee discount platform including retailers, entertainment, eating out, travel and more
  • Share in Santander's success by investing in our share plans
  • Support your favourite causes through charitable giving and our community partnerships
